新聞中心
php,require_once 'PHPExcel.php';,$objPHPExcel = PHPExcel_IOFactory::load('文件路徑.xls');,$sheetData = $objPHPExcel->getActiveSheet()->toArray();,“,,這段代碼將讀取指定的 XLS 文件,并將其內(nèi)容轉(zhuǎn)換為一個(gè)二維數(shù)組。在PHP中,我們可以使用多種方法來(lái)讀取XLS文件,一種常見(jiàn)的方法是使用庫(kù),如 PHPExcel 或 PhpSpreadsheet(它是PHPExcel的繼承者),以下是如何使用PhpSpreadsheet讀取XLS文件的一個(gè)基本示例:

getActiveSheet(); $data = $worksheet>toArray(); print_r($data); ?>
在這個(gè)例子中,我們首先加載了Composer的autoload.php文件,然后使用IOFactory::load()函數(shù)加載XLS文件。getActiveSheet()方法獲取當(dāng)前活動(dòng)的工作表,toArray()方法將工作表轉(zhuǎn)換為數(shù)組,我們打印出數(shù)據(jù)。
相關(guān)問(wèn)題與解答:
Q1: 如果我想讀取多個(gè)工作表怎么辦?
A1: 你可以通過(guò)調(diào)用getSheet()方法并傳入工作表的索引或者名稱(chēng)來(lái)獲取特定的工作表。$worksheet = $spreadsheet>getSheet(1);會(huì)獲取第二個(gè)工作表。
Q2: 我如何只讀取特定的單元格?
A2: 你可以使用getCell()方法來(lái)獲取特定的單元格。$cellValue = $worksheet>getCell('A1')>getValue();會(huì)獲取A1單元格的值。
網(wǎng)站欄目:php如何??入xls文件
URL網(wǎng)址:http://fisionsoft.com.cn/article/dpchedc.html


咨詢(xún)
建站咨詢(xún)
